The wedding day In the church were 2,000 guests, among them US First Lady Nancy Reagan and Prime Minister Margaret Thatcher – and 30,000 flowers. The service was conducted by the Archbishop of Canterbury, Dr Robert Runcie, with Prince Edward as the supporter (best man), and Prince Charles read the lesson.

Who were Sarah Ferguson’s bridesmaids?

Bridesmaids and page boys:

  • Lady Rosanagh Innes-Ker, age: 7 the daughter of Guy Innes-Ker, 10th Duke of Roxburghe.
  • Alice Ferguson, age: 6 younger half-sister of the bride.
  • Laura Fellowes, age: 6 the daughter of Diana’s sister Jane Fellowes, Baroness Fellowes.
  • Zara Phillips age: 5 niece of the groom.

The ceremony took 45 minutes and was attended by the royal family, the Ferguson family, Margaret Thatcher and Nancy Reagan. Andrew’s brother, Prince Edward, was his best man, and Sarah had four bridesmaids and four page boys. Fergie’s wedding dress had a corset top and a duchesse satin train.

Prince Andrew, accompanied by his best man Prince Edward, waves as he leaves Buckingham Palace in an open carriage to go to his own wedding. A young Prince William as a page boy with bridesmaid Laura Fellowes at his uncle’s wedding. Sarah walking with her father, Major Ronald Ferguson.

In an effort to honor Prince Andrew’s career in the navy, the page boys wore sailor outfits while the bridesmaids wore poufy peach dresses with lace ruffled trim. The rest of the wedding party was made up of four bridesmaids and four page boys, which included Prince Andrew’s niece, Zara and his nephew Peter —Princess Anne’s children.

When did Prince Andrew and Fergie get married?

Prince Andrew and Sarah “Fergie” Ferguson tied the knot on July 23, 1986 at Westminster Abbey in London, England. The two first met as young children, and reacquainted years later as teenagers before eventually dating and getting engaged.
